Sharks’ draft spot represents critical rebuilding moment

Hockey hasn’t been played in San Jose for more than two months, but that didn’t stop Doug Wilson from suggesting the Sharks have reached a critical point.

San Jose’s general manager is executing his plan to rebuild on the fly after the team missed the Stanley Cup playoffs for the first time under his watch of 11 years.

“This is probably the most important phase of the process we’ve gone through in the last year,” he said.

The next step for Wilson & Co. comes in the NHL’s two-day entry draft, which begins Friday in Sunrise, Fla.
